About Gae-won You

Gae-won You is a scholar working on Signal Processing, Geography, Planning and Development and Automotive Engineering, having authored 19 papers that have together received 669 indexed citations. Recurring topics across this work include Data Management and Algorithms (9 papers), Topic Modeling (5 papers) and Geographic Information Systems Studies (4 papers). The work is most often cited by research in Automotive Engineering (434 citations), Signal Processing (125 citations) and Geography, Planning and Development (58 citations). Gae-won You has collaborated with scholars based in South Korea, China and United States. Frequent co-authors include Dukjin Oh, Sangdo Park, Seung-won Hwang, Jongwuk Lee, Hyeonseung Im, Seung-won Hwang, Zaiqing Nie, Navendu Jain, Ji-Rong Wen and Wolf‐Tilo Balke. Their work appears in journals such as IEEE Transactions on Industrial Electronics, Applied Energy and Information Sciences.
